要开发一个免费短剧App并对接穿山甲广告平台,你需要遵循一系列步骤来确保App的顺利开发和广告平台的有效集成。以下是一个大致的开发流程:
1. 需求分析与规划
明确目标:确定App的主要功能(如短剧播放、用户交互、内容推荐等)和广告展示的需求。
市场调研:了解竞争对手的App和广告策略,以便差异化竞争。
用户画像:确定目标用户群体,并了解他们的需求和习惯。
2. 技术选型与团队组建
前端技术:选择适合移动应用的开发框架,如ReactNative、Flutter或原生开发(iOS的Swift/Objective-C,Android的Java/Kotlin)。
后端技术:确定后端服务器的开发语言和框架,如Node.js、Django、SpringBoot等,以及数据库技术(如MySQL、MongoDB)。
组建团队:根据项目需求组建包括前端、后端、UI/UX设计师、测试工程师等在内的开发团队。
3. App开发
用户界面设计:设计简洁、直观、用户友好的界面,确保良好的用户体验。
短剧内容管理:开发内容管理系统,支持短剧的上传、审核、分类和展示。
用户系统:实现用户注册、登录、个人信息管理等功能。
视频播放:集成视频播放器,支持短剧的流畅播放和控制。
4. 穿山甲广告平台对接
注册穿山甲账号:在穿山甲广告平台注册账号,并完成相关认证。
获取SDK:从穿山甲广告平台下载适用于你App开发平台的SDK。
集成SDK:将SDK集成到你的App中,并按照穿山甲提供的文档进行配置。
广告位设计:在App中设计合理的广告位,以平衡用户体验和广告收益。
广告展示逻辑:编写代码逻辑来控制广告的展示时机和频率,确保不违反用户体验。
5. 测试与优化
功能测试:对App的各项功能进行全面测试,确保正常运行。
广告测试:测试广告的展示效果,包括加载速度、点击率等。
性能优化:根据测试结果进行性能优化,提高App的响应速度和稳定性。
用户体验优化:根据用户反馈进行界面和交互的优化,提升用户体验。
6. 部署上线
发布到应用商店:将App提交到各大应用商店进行审核和发布。
监测与数据分析:使用穿山甲提供的数据分析工具监测广告效果和用户行为,以便进行后续的优化和策略调整。
7. 注意事项
遵守平台政策:确保你的App和广告策略符合穿山甲广告平台及各大应用商店的政策要求。
保护用户隐私:在收集和使用用户数据时,要遵守相关法律法规和隐私政策。
持续优化:根据用户反馈和市场变化持续优化App功能和广告策略。
通过以上步骤,你可以开发一个免费短剧App并成功对接穿山甲广告平台,实现通过广告收益来支持App的运营和发展。